Broadcast 3786 Michael Castle-Miller
Guest: Michael Castle-Miller: Topics: The NSS Space Settlement Event and Business Plan Competition plus an examination of Michael's concept known as the Lunar Development Cooperative.
Michael is a governance consultant who has served as an advisor to governments, international organizations, civil society, and private investors in over 25 countries. He specializes in the legal and public policy frameworks for special jurisdictions -- such as special economic zones and semi-autonomous areas -- that improve institutional governance for developing countries. He has drafted laws and regulations, helped create administrative agencies, design policy reforms, and structure public-private partnerships. He is the Founder and Executive Director of Politas, which provides innovative legal and policy solutions to help cities and special jurisdictions achieve inclusive growth.
Michael's professional experience ranges from legal and policy consulting to real estate negotiation, and from organizational management to community engagement. Michael was the Managing Director of Locus Economica, a boutique SEZ consulting firm advising on numerous World Bank, UNIDO, and direct-government projects. Michael also served as a consultant with the World Bank, working on urban law and development issues. Before that, he worked for the Public International Law and Policy Group.
Michael earned a J.D., summa cum laude, from American University, Washington College of Law and an M.A. in International Politics from American University, School of International Service. His work has been featured in National Geographic, fDi Magazine, der Standard, Christian Science Monitor, and Weltwoche. His publications in legal journals cover the political economy of international trade and investment, comparative local government, “Charter Cities,” U.S. immigration law, and expropriation jurisprudence. He has given talks and participated in panel discussions on special jurisdictions at several conferences internationally.
Michael is a member of the Pacific Council on International Policy and a Senior Program Officer of WEPZA, a trade association of SEZ practitioners. He is also an active member of the New York State Bar Association and licensed to practice law in New York.
Michael is also the founder and lead of the Lunar Development Cooperative (LDC) Working Group and developed the LDC concept. The LDC will be a public-private partnership that provides infrastructure and critical public services to enable a thriving human settlement on the Moon. The LDC is designed to generate a profit by capturing rising land values on the Moon. He formed this concept and group in collaboration with space experts from the National Space Society and other space organizations.
